TEAL, a colorless, pyrophoric liquid, requires specialized handling due to its reactivity with air and moisture, making the selection of a reliable Triethylaluminum supplier a critical decision for any user.
The primary demand for Triethylaluminum for sale is driven by its indispensable role as a co-catalyst in Ziegler-Natta polymerization. This catalytic system is foundational for producing various polyolefins, including polyethylene and polypropylene, which are ubiquitous in modern manufacturing. The high purity of TEAL directly correlates with the efficiency of the polymerization process and the quality of the final polymer. Beyond its significant impact on polymer science, TEAL is highly valued in organic synthesis for its capabilities as an alkylating agent and its utility in facilitating various complex chemical transformations. Its strong Lewis acidity makes it an active participant in many reactions, enabling the creation of intricate molecular structures.
